Commit 646d11e9970a2edd370b7026e52db4004f5a948a
Committed by
GitHub
Merge pull request #4037 from Terny22/paginator-new-buttons
Added First/Last page-buttons to the tables-paginator
Showing
5 changed files
with
10 additions
and
5 deletions
... | ... | @@ -195,7 +195,8 @@ |
195 | 195 | [length]="dataSource.total() | async" |
196 | 196 | [pageIndex]="pageLink.page" |
197 | 197 | [pageSize]="pageLink.pageSize" |
198 | - [pageSizeOptions]="[10, 20, 30]"></mat-paginator> | |
198 | + [pageSizeOptions]="[10, 20, 30]" | |
199 | + showFirstLastButtons></mat-paginator> | |
199 | 200 | <ngx-hm-carousel fxFlex *ngIf="mode === 'widget' && widgetsList.length > 0" |
200 | 201 | #carousel |
201 | 202 | [(ngModel)]="widgetsCarouselIndex" | ... | ... |
... | ... | @@ -238,7 +238,8 @@ |
238 | 238 | [length]="dataSource.total() | async" |
239 | 239 | [pageIndex]="pageLink.page" |
240 | 240 | [pageSize]="pageLink.pageSize" |
241 | - [pageSizeOptions]="pageSizeOptions"></mat-paginator> | |
241 | + [pageSizeOptions]="pageSizeOptions" | |
242 | + showFirstLastButtons></mat-paginator> | |
242 | 243 | </div> |
243 | 244 | </div> |
244 | 245 | </mat-drawer-content> | ... | ... |
... | ... | @@ -140,6 +140,7 @@ |
140 | 140 | [length]="alarmsDatasource.total() | async" |
141 | 141 | [pageIndex]="pageLink.page" |
142 | 142 | [pageSize]="pageLink.pageSize" |
143 | - [pageSizeOptions]="pageSizeOptions"></mat-paginator> | |
143 | + [pageSizeOptions]="pageSizeOptions" | |
144 | + showFirstLastButtons></mat-paginator> | |
144 | 145 | </div> |
145 | 146 | </div> | ... | ... |
... | ... | @@ -99,6 +99,7 @@ |
99 | 99 | [length]="entityDatasource.total() | async" |
100 | 100 | [pageIndex]="pageLink.page" |
101 | 101 | [pageSize]="pageLink.pageSize" |
102 | - [pageSizeOptions]="pageSizeOptions"></mat-paginator> | |
102 | + [pageSizeOptions]="pageSizeOptions" | |
103 | + showFirstLastButtons></mat-paginator> | |
103 | 104 | </div> |
104 | 105 | </div> | ... | ... |
... | ... | @@ -104,7 +104,8 @@ |
104 | 104 | [length]="source.timeseriesDatasource.total() | async" |
105 | 105 | [pageIndex]="source.pageLink.page" |
106 | 106 | [pageSize]="source.pageLink.pageSize" |
107 | - [pageSizeOptions]="pageSizeOptions"></mat-paginator> | |
107 | + [pageSizeOptions]="pageSizeOptions" | |
108 | + showFirstLastButtons></mat-paginator> | |
108 | 109 | </mat-tab> |
109 | 110 | </mat-tab-group> |
110 | 111 | </div> | ... | ... |